About BASF:

BASF is a nonprofit organization and the oldest voluntary bar association in California. Today, over 7,400 San Francisco lawyers are members of BASF, which prides itself as being one of the most active and innovative local bar associations. In addition to services and benefits to our members, BASF provides a variety of legal services to San Francisco residents including our Lawyer Referral and Information Service, Alternative Dispute Resolution, and the Justice & Diversity Center (including the Homeless Advocacy Project) which is the largest provider of legal services to San Franciscans.

About the Justice and Diversity Center of BASF:
JDC is a non-profit organization that provides free legal services through its staff and volunteers to low-income Bay Area residents. Each year more than 1,600 volunteer attorneys, legal assistants, and law students work with JDC staff to serve nearly 7,500 indigent clients. JDC’s holistic advocacy approach seeks to address the social service and legal needs of clients.

About the Job:

The Justice and Diversity Center of The Bar Association of San Francisco is the host of the Attorney of the Day Program, which provides consultations to unrepresented respondents on the day of their initial court hearings. We are excited to hire our first Staff Attorney, Attorney of the Day (AOD) who will consult with and provide limited scope representation to unrepresented individuals and families facing removal on the detained, non-detained and juvenile dockets at the San Francisco Immigration Court. The Staff Attorney, AOD will create protocols to provide unrepresented respondents more continuous and robust services. The Staff Attorney, AOD will also liaise with the court and attorney volunteers, and train attorney volunteers and participate in data collection and analysis.

The duties and responsibilities commensurate with the role of the Staff Attorney, AOD include, but are not limited to, any combination of the following tasks:

• Conduct consultations with unrepresented respondents and advocate for them on the non-detained adult and juvenile dockets and detained adult dockets at the San Francisco Immigration Court
• Oversee the intakes and referrals collected from the AOD Program, with a priority to conducting follow-up services for San Francisco and Santa Clara County residents.
• Assist in the training of and communication with volunteer AODs in the JDC AOD Program.
• Work closely with the AOD Attorney Coordinator and JDC’s partners to design strategies and materials to protect the interests of indigent and/or pro se respondents before the Immigration Court.
• Carry a small caseload of limited and full scope cases in removal proceedings.
Work closely with the ILDP Director and AOD Attorney Coordinator to design and analyze data collection from the AOD program to meet the SFILDC, SCC, CCIJ’s, and JDC’s needs.
